Resource Development Work closely with CEO and key program staff to backss funding needs and priorities and develop realistic annual and long-term fundraising goals. Collaborate with internal teams and key volunteers to create and implement multi-year resource development plan to drive annual, major and planned gifts to support the organization. Recruit, train and staff Development Committee consisting of Board
Members and community volunteers to help execute development plan and raise funds for FCNMHP as requested.
Expand individual giving program including annual fund, middle donor program and major gifts strategy. Support Capital Campaign efforts, in partnership with the CEO, including prospect research, soliciting major gifts and pledges from individuals and corporations, assist with the development of capital campaign marketing materials, and during the public phase plan events, press releases, and media coverage to reach CC fundraising goals. Support CEO in managing a portfolio of individual donors for cultivation, solicitation and stewardship. Establish and maintain excellent relationships with current donors and identify/cultivate new relationships to generate funds from individuals, corporations and foundations.
Maintain active portfolio of major donors and prospects and utilize a moves management program to track cultivation, solicitation and stewardship activities. Develop donor stewardship processes and activities to ensure the accurate entry and timely acknowledgement of gifts made to the organization. Lead efforts throughout the organization to properly steward gifts and donors. Ensure proper systems and policies are in place to accept/record gifts and maintain donor and prospect records, Oversee the grants strategy including the development and writing of foundation, corporate and government proposals.
Promote planned gifts to the organization and strengthen comprehensive planned giving program. Nonprofit and Fundraising Jobs refer to employment opportunities within organizations that operate on a not-for-profit basis, aiming to address social, environmental, or cultural issues. These jobs are characterized by their focus on mobilizing resources, enhancing community engagement, and driving philanthropic initiatives to support an organization's mission. Personnel in this field often possess strong communication skills, a passion for advocacy and change, and a dedication to the cause they serve. The roles can range from event coordination and grant writing to donor management and campaign strategy, all essential for sustaining the financial health and impact of the nonprofit sector.
